This report seeks final confirmation of the recommendations to Council, on 24 February 2017, in respect of the revenue budget, capital programme and council tax for 2017/18.
On 9 January 2017, the Executive reviewed the Council’s overall finance strategy and considered proposals relating to the capital programme, revenue budgets and the council tax for 2017/18. This report updates the Council’s budgets to reflect the decisions taken on 9 January 2017 The capital programme for the years 2016/17 to 2020/21 will be £65,686,000.
The revenue budget for 2017/18 will be £8,616,700. With Central Government support and retained business rates estimated to be £2,161,654 and use of collection fund balance of £89,984 this results in the total amount due from the council tax of £6,365,062.
Taking these changes into consideration, the council tax for 2017/18 will be £150.22 per Band D property and would be within the referendum limit set by the Government.
RESOLVED that the Executive approves and recommends to the meeting of the Council to be held on 24 February 2017:-
(a) the capital programme and financing of £63,686,000;
(b) an overall revised revenue budget for 2016/17 of £8,903,300;
(c) a revenue budget for 2017/18 of £8,616,700; and
(d) a council tax for Fareham Borough Council for 2017/18 of £150.22 per band D property, which represents a £5.00 increase when compared to the current year and is within referendum limits.
